  • Title

    A fuzzy fault diagnosis method applied to a steam circuit

  • Abstract
    This paper presents a hierarchical scheme of a fault detection and isolation (FDI) procedure based on a decision support system (DSS). Knowledge based procedure, analytic symptoms and heuristic information are combined in order to achieve the fault diagnosis task. Then, using a pattern recognition method, a unified representation of all symptoms and a fuzzy expert system are integrated in the diagnostic tool. The results obtained with this approach on the steam circuit in a waste water treatment plant are compared with those obtained with structured residuals using a modified Hamming´s distance
